Title: Achim Von Kathen: Innovator in Turbomachinery

Introduction

Achim Von Kathen is a notable inventor based in Wuppertal,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of turbomachinery, holding a total of eight patents. His innovative designs focus on improving the efficiency and functionality of side channel machines and compressors.

Latest Patents

Among his latest patents is an impeller specifically designed for side channel machines. This invention features blades arranged in a circumferential direction, forming open blade chambers. The design includes a unique blade wall that optimizes the impeller's performance by ensuring that the radius dimensions are strategically aligned. Another significant patent is an air filter attachment for turbomachines, particularly side channel compressors. This invention enhances the air filtration process by utilizing a housing that extends laterally relative to the inlet and outlet openings, thereby improving the overall efficiency of the turbomachine.
